Employee Involvement and Commitment in Internal Communication

Abstract: This research project aims to analyze the importance of internal communication in organizations in Benguela (Angola) and to determine its impact on employee engagement and commitment to the organization. To this end, an exploratory study was conducted using a quantitative methodology. In this scope, a questionnaire was applied to 250 employees of the organizations, seeking to evaluate employees as internal consumers; internal communication in terms of tools, means and communicative effectiveness, as well as in… Show more

“…Togna (2014) found that trust in the Italian company he studied is at the center of the triadic relationship between communication, trust, and commitment, and that faceto-face communication is essential for moving from the stage of trust to the stage of commitment. Meirinhos et al (2022) conducted a study in Angola and concluded that internal communication is a necessary management tool for any organization that seeks to increase its performance. Thus, we can appreciate that effective internal communication can help to build trust, create a sense of community, and ensure that employees are aligned with the organization's goals.…”
